.products-hero[data-astro-cid-ttgomkr6]{position:relative;min-height:clamp(44rem,82svh,54rem);overflow:hidden;background:#181612;color:#fff}.products-hero__image[data-astro-cid-ttgomkr6]{position:absolute;inset:0;background:linear-gradient(90deg,#12110ef7,#12110ee0,#12110ebd),repeating-linear-gradient(90deg,rgba(255,255,255,.045) 0 1px,transparent 1px 88px),repeating-linear-gradient(0deg,rgba(255,255,255,.035) 0 1px,transparent 1px 88px)}.products-hero__inner[data-astro-cid-ttgomkr6]{position:relative;z-index:1;display:grid;grid-template-columns:minmax(0,.95fr) minmax(20rem,.82fr);gap:clamp(2rem,6vw,6rem);align-items:center;min-height:clamp(44rem,82svh,54rem);padding-top:5rem;padding-bottom:clamp(3rem,7vw,6rem)}.products-hero__copy[data-astro-cid-ttgomkr6]{max-width:48rem}.products-eyebrow[data-astro-cid-ttgomkr6]{margin:0 0 var(--space-sm);color:var(--color-gold);font-family:var(--font-ui);font-size:var(--text-xs);font-weight:700;letter-spacing:.08em;text-transform:uppercase}.products-hero[data-astro-cid-ttgomkr6] h1[data-astro-cid-ttgomkr6],.products-featured[data-astro-cid-ttgomkr6] h2[data-astro-cid-ttgomkr6]{max-width:11ch;margin:0;color:inherit;font-family:var(--font-display);font-size:clamp(3rem,7vw,6.5rem);font-weight:500;line-height:.96}.products-hero[data-astro-cid-ttgomkr6] p[data-astro-cid-ttgomkr6]:not(.products-eyebrow){max-width:44rem;margin:var(--space-lg) 0 0;color:#ffffffd6;font-size:clamp(1.1rem,2vw,1.3rem);line-height:1.6}.products-metrics[data-astro-cid-ttgomkr6]{display:flex;flex-wrap:wrap;gap:1px;margin-top:var(--space-lg);max-width:48rem;background:#ffffff2e}.products-metrics[data-astro-cid-ttgomkr6] span[data-astro-cid-ttgomkr6]{display:grid;gap:.2rem;min-width:10rem;padding:1rem;background:#ffffff14;color:#ffffffc7;font-family:var(--font-ui);font-size:var(--text-xs);font-weight:700;text-transform:uppercase}.products-metrics[data-astro-cid-ttgomkr6] b[data-astro-cid-ttgomkr6]{color:#fff;font-family:var(--font-display);font-size:2rem;line-height:1;text-transform:none}.products-hero__stack[data-astro-cid-ttgomkr6]{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:0;align-items:center;min-height:32rem}.products-hero__stack[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]{width:min(14rem,100%)}.products-hero__stack[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]:nth-child(1){transform:translate(3rem,.8rem) rotate(-4deg)}.products-hero__stack[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]:nth-child(2){z-index:2;width:min(17rem,100%)}.products-hero__stack[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]:nth-child(3){transform:translate(-3rem,1.2rem) rotate(5deg)}.products-featured[data-astro-cid-ttgomkr6]{padding:var(--space-section) 0}.products-featured__inner[data-astro-cid-ttgomkr6]{display:grid;grid-template-columns:minmax(0,.95fr) minmax(18rem,.75fr);gap:clamp(2rem,7vw,7rem);align-items:end}.products-featured[data-astro-cid-ttgomkr6] h2[data-astro-cid-ttgomkr6]{color:var(--color-text)}.products-featured[data-astro-cid-ttgomkr6] p[data-astro-cid-ttgomkr6]:not(.products-eyebrow){color:var(--color-text-muted);line-height:1.75}.products-list[data-astro-cid-ttgomkr6]{padding:0 0 var(--space-section)}.product-shelf[data-astro-cid-ttgomkr6]{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:clamp(1rem,2vw,1.5rem)}.product-card[data-astro-cid-ttgomkr6]{display:grid;grid-template-rows:auto 1fr;min-height:100%;padding:1rem;border:1px solid var(--color-border);background:color-mix(in srgb,var(--color-surface) 94%,var(--product-shade) 6%);color:inherit;text-decoration:none;transition:transform var(--duration) var(--ease),border-color var(--duration) var(--ease),box-shadow var(--duration) var(--ease)}.product-card[data-astro-cid-ttgomkr6]:hover{border-color:var(--product-accent);box-shadow:0 22px 44px #2c2c2c1c;transform:translateY(-.25rem)}.product-workbook[data-astro-cid-ttgomkr6]{position:relative;width:min(100%,15rem);aspect-ratio:.72;margin-inline:auto;perspective:1000px}.product-workbook__cover[data-astro-cid-ttgomkr6]{position:absolute;inset:0;display:flex;flex-direction:column;justify-content:space-between;padding:clamp(1rem,2vw,1.4rem);background:linear-gradient(135deg,rgba(255,255,255,.34),transparent 34%),linear-gradient(160deg,var(--product-shade),#fffaf0 56%,color-mix(in srgb,var(--product-accent) 18%,#ffffff));border:1px solid color-mix(in srgb,var(--product-accent) 38%,#ffffff);box-shadow:18px 22px 42px #2c2c2c2e;transform:rotateY(-18deg) rotateX(4deg) rotate(-1deg);transform-origin:left center}.product-workbook__cover[data-astro-cid-ttgomkr6]:before{content:"";position:absolute;inset:0 auto 0 0;width:12%;background:linear-gradient(90deg,#0000002e,#ffffff14),var(--product-accent)}.product-workbook__cover[data-astro-cid-ttgomkr6]:after{content:"";position:absolute;inset:7% 7% auto auto;width:28%;aspect-ratio:1;border:1px solid color-mix(in srgb,var(--product-accent) 55%,#ffffff);background:linear-gradient(90deg,transparent 46%,color-mix(in srgb,var(--product-accent) 55%,transparent) 46% 54%,transparent 54%),linear-gradient(0deg,transparent 46%,color-mix(in srgb,var(--product-accent) 55%,transparent) 46% 54%,transparent 54%);opacity:.8}.product-workbook__cover[data-astro-cid-ttgomkr6] span[data-astro-cid-ttgomkr6],.product-workbook__cover[data-astro-cid-ttgomkr6] em[data-astro-cid-ttgomkr6]{position:relative;z-index:1;font-family:var(--font-ui);font-style:normal}.product-workbook__cover[data-astro-cid-ttgomkr6] span[data-astro-cid-ttgomkr6]{margin-left:13%;color:var(--product-accent);font-size:.68rem;font-weight:800;text-transform:uppercase}.product-workbook__cover[data-astro-cid-ttgomkr6] strong[data-astro-cid-ttgomkr6]{position:relative;z-index:1;display:block;margin-left:13%;color:#26231f;font-family:var(--font-display);font-size:clamp(1.48rem,2.8vw,2.45rem);font-weight:600;line-height:.96}.product-workbook__cover[data-astro-cid-ttgomkr6] div[data-astro-cid-ttgomkr6]{position:relative;z-index:1;display:grid;gap:.45rem;margin-left:13%}.product-workbook__cover[data-astro-cid-ttgomkr6] em[data-astro-cid-ttgomkr6]{padding-top:.45rem;border-top:1px solid color-mix(in srgb,var(--product-accent) 22%,#ffffff);color:#625a52;font-size:.72rem;font-weight:700}.product-card__body[data-astro-cid-ttgomkr6]{display:grid;gap:var(--space-sm);padding-top:var(--space-lg)}.product-card__meta[data-astro-cid-ttgomkr6]{display:flex;flex-wrap:wrap;gap:.5rem;color:var(--product-accent);font-family:var(--font-ui);font-size:var(--text-xs);font-weight:700;text-transform:uppercase}.product-card__body[data-astro-cid-ttgomkr6] h2[data-astro-cid-ttgomkr6]{margin:0;font-family:var(--font-display);font-size:clamp(1.45rem,2vw,1.9rem);font-weight:500;line-height:1.1}.product-card__body[data-astro-cid-ttgomkr6] p[data-astro-cid-ttgomkr6]{margin:0;color:var(--color-text-muted);line-height:1.6}.product-card__footer[data-astro-cid-ttgomkr6]{display:flex;justify-content:space-between;gap:var(--space-md);align-items:center;margin-top:var(--space-sm);padding-top:var(--space-md);border-top:1px solid var(--color-border);font-family:var(--font-ui)}.product-card__footer[data-astro-cid-ttgomkr6] strong[data-astro-cid-ttgomkr6]{color:var(--product-accent)}.product-card__footer[data-astro-cid-ttgomkr6] span[data-astro-cid-ttgomkr6]{color:var(--color-text-muted);font-size:var(--text-xs);font-weight:700;text-transform:uppercase}@media(max-width:760px){.products-hero__inner[data-astro-cid-ttgomkr6],.products-featured__inner[data-astro-cid-ttgomkr6],.product-shelf[data-astro-cid-ttgomkr6]{grid-template-columns:1fr}.products-hero__inner[data-astro-cid-ttgomkr6]{min-height:auto;padding-top:4rem}.products-hero__stack[data-astro-cid-ttgomkr6]{grid-template-columns:repeat(3,minmax(0,1fr));min-height:14rem;padding-top:var(--space-lg)}.products-hero__stack[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]{width:7.5rem}.products-hero__stack[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]:nth-child(1){transform:translate(1.6rem,1.4rem) rotate(-4deg)}.products-hero__stack[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]:nth-child(2){width:8.2rem}.products-hero__stack[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]:nth-child(3){transform:translate(-1.6rem,1.8rem) rotate(5deg)}.product-card[data-astro-cid-ttgomkr6]{grid-template-columns:7.25rem minmax(0,1fr);grid-template-rows:auto;gap:var(--space-lg);align-items:center}.product-card[data-astro-cid-ttgomkr6] .product-workbook[data-astro-cid-ttgomkr6]{width:7.25rem}.product-card__body[data-astro-cid-ttgomkr6]{padding-top:0}}@media(min-width:761px)and (max-width:1120px){.product-shelf[data-astro-cid-ttgomkr6]{grid-template-columns:repeat(2,minmax(0,1fr))}}
